Human rights at the heart of the meeting between Hassan II of Morocco and François Mitterrand
Franco-Moroccan relations are not in "good stead", contrary to what the king of Morocco HASSAN II says to journalists at the end of his first interview with President François Mitterrand. Indeed, the subjects of dissent exist, including the rapprochement of France with Algeria, the fate of Western Sahara and especially human rights. The release of socialist opponent Abderrahim Bouabid is important to the French head of state.
